Proven Outcomes
The hype behind FreeStyle Libre 2 isn’t based on opinion. There are proven outcomes for both pediatric and adult users:
Pediatric Outcomes
- Reduced A1c – 0.7% A1c improvement in teens with diabetes
- Increased time in the target range – increased time in glucose target range by one hour a day
- Increased glucose monitoring frequency – average 13 times a day
- Reduced time in hyperglycemia – reduction of 1.2 hours per day
- Reduced fear of hypoglycemia – helped ease the fear of and reduced the frequency of hypoglycemia in teens with type 1 diabetes
Adult Outcomes
- Reduced A1c – patients with type 2 diabetes experienced a 1.5% A1c reduction
- Increased target range with increased scan rate – 38.5 scans/day correlated with 43% more time in the target range
- Frequent glucose monitoring – an average of 12 times per day
- Reduced time in hypoglycemia – reduction of 38% in type one diabetes patients and 43% in type 2 diabetes
- Reduced hospital admissions – 47% reduction for diabetic ketoacidosis (DKA) in type 2 diabetes patients; reduction in DKA and hypoglycemia admissions in type one diabetes patients from 3.3% to 2.2%; patients experienced a 66% reduction in diabetes-related hospital admissions
The Sensor, Reader, & App
FreeStyle Libre 2 is easy to use. Between the sensor, reader, and app, you can track your glucose levels and share them as needed.
- Sensor – small and discreet (easy for patients); applied to the back of the upper arm for up to 14 days and nights; water-resistant; patients can scan to get their glucose level as much as they want
- Reader – comes with FreeStyle Libre so patients can access real-time glucose readings that allow them to make informed diabetes management decisions
- App – lets a patient scan their sensor with their smartphone; works best by swiping your iPhone by the top middle part of the phone where the speaker is located; will store all glucose level data in one place and makes it easily accessible to the patient’s care team
- LibreLinkUp app – allows every scan to be sent to a caregiver’s smartphone automatically
